The Environmental Services Program (ESP), a USAID project managed by DAI, is recruiting a position of Regional Coordinator for West Java to be based in Bandung.

The
Regional Coordinator for West Java will work in three realms of tasks
and responsibilities: technical and programmatic, project management
and administration, and representation of ESP.




Technical and Programmatic
- Provide technical and strategic management, guidance, and supervision to ESP technical staff working in his/her region;
-
Provide technical and strategic guidance to ESP specialists on issues
related to protected areas management, eco-regional planning, watershed
management and service delivery;
- Oversee development of West Java components of work plans;
- Manage regional project budget, and oversee related finances;
-
Manage tracking and achievement of performance indicators and project
deliverables, specifically related to his/her region; and
- Lead efforts to establish and maintain linkages with related projects and stakeholders in the region.

Project Management and Administration
- Provide support for financial and administrative management for West Java ESP activities;
-
Provide leadership and supervision of field activities in his/her
region, including office management and identifying and establishing
partner relationships;
- Ensure timely reporting of project achievements and results, including but not limited to quarterly and annual reports;
- Facilitate collaboration and coordination with other USAID programs working in his/her, especially those in the BHS SO; and
-
Supervise technical and administrative staff to ensure timely
achievement and reporting of administrative and technical results.

Representation
- Act as the ESP representative to government and non-government partners in his/her region.
